Last issue we looked at the huge explosion in sales of security cameras, which are now far and away the most popular products in the entire smart home category.

But while a security camera is the ideal starting point for your home security system, even the most advanced models have their limitations. A camera can only look out for activity in one specific room or location, and even cameras that have a night-vision mode can only see things a few yards away once it gets really dark.
